Good:hair, face, belly button, hands and pacifier, and yes the bum shot. Genius at putting jingle bells in the tummy, LOVE that; and I think a child would also.
Needs improvement: thread choices, and filling. I would prefer the sculpting thread match the fabric so they were less visible, and your embroidery will need to be smaller stitching so that little fingers don't pull through them. On the filling, I like the texture of a split pea, however you could never wash it, perhaps those plastic pellets instead? Both easily fixed and perhaps just demo'd on the prototype.
